The cellular notification and control system KSITAL GSM-4T is designed for remote monitoring and control of stationary non-telephonized objects using a cellular phone. It can be: a house, a summer house, an apartment, an office, a warehouse, a retail outlet, a garage, etc.

Using SMS and voice dialing, the system informs about the operation of various sensors connected to the controller inputs. These can be motion, vibration, glass breaking, smoke, gas leakage, flooding, pressure sensors, or just a doorbell. The message text for each input can be changed according to the purpose of the sensor.

Messages are sent sequentially to a pre-recorded list of phones.

Upon receipt of an SMS message with a control command, the controller can turn on or turn off any of the three relays built into it. In this way, various devices such as heating, sauna, pumps, lighting, etc. can be remotely controlled. from a cell phone.

One built-in and up to five remote temperature sensors continuously measure the temperature in the room. The system collects data from all connected temperature sensors and sends them in a report in the form of a table.

When the room temperature goes beyond the specified range, SMS messages about this are sent to cell phones, the numbers of which are previously entered in the telephone directory on the SIM card.

The system has a mode of automatic maintenance of the temperature in the room, controlling the heating system using a built-in relay. The stabilization temperature value is set by an SMS command from a remote cell phone. You can simultaneously set two room temperature values ​​- day and night. This will allow in case electric heating Significantly save on electricity bills by setting the night temperature higher than the daytime temperature. At the same time, heating will mainly work at night, warming up the room at a cheaper rate.

The following can be easily connected to the controller: an external status indicator "under control", for example, a street light annunciator, or a control panel for an additional alarm system.

If there is a possibility of a 220V voltage shutdown at the facility, then a 12V backup battery must be used, which will be charged by the controller as needed.

If there is a backup battery, the system remains fully operational during a 220V power outage, reports the loss/appearance of voltage and the discharge of the backup battery.

There are two SIM-card readers installed on the controller board, one for the main and one for the backup operator. The system will automatically switch to a backup operator in case of loss of the network of the main operator or failures in the transmission of SMS through it. The possibility of sound control of the room with the help of additional external microphones is provided.

The presence of two Xital GSM systems, remote from each other and configured as "partners", allows you to timely fix problems with the cellular network or the use of jamming radio signals.

The system is intended for installation inside a monitored facility and is designed for round-the-clock operation at temperatures from -350C to +500C.

The power consumed by the system from the AC mains is not more than 10 watts.
Number of built-in relays - 3.
The maximum switched power of the relay contacts is 200 watts.
The number of control zones (entrances) - 4.
The maximum number of phone numbers for sending SMS messages is 10.
Maximum number of telephone numbers for dialing with a voice message
"Anxiety!" - ten.
Overall dimensions of the controller - 15 x 11 x 4 cm.
Package size - 25 x 16 x 6 cm.
Weight with packaging - 850 g.

CONTROLLER KSITAL GSM-4T

INTEGRATED DEVICES

Built-in GSM module
temperature sensor
Backup battery charger and uninterruptible power supply system
Touch Memory electronic key controller
Relay for controlling additional devices (3 pcs.)

The built-in temperature sensor is located on the controller board inside the case. The sensor has an accuracy of ±1.50С.

The backup battery is charged in the presence of a 220V network.

The charge level of the backup battery is not guaranteed when the mains voltage is below 200V or when using a non-standard adapter.

In the presence of a backup battery, the controller provides uninterrupted power to the sensors connected to it constant voltage 12V.

The controller of the Touch Memory electronic key reader is implemented on the KSITAL GSM board. Digital code packets pass through the wires connecting the reader and the controller. This eliminates the possibility of controlling the controller modes by manipulating the wiring, such as removing from control without having a registered key.

The KSITAL GSM controller has 3 built-in relays. The relay output contacts are brought to the external terminals. Relays are used for automatic or SMS-command control of various devices. Relay contacts are designed for voltage up to 240V. For reasons of reliability and durability of the relay, it is undesirable to connect powerful devices (more than 200 watts) directly to the controller.

SIM READERS

The controller board has two SIM card readers, labeled SIM1 and SIM2. The SIM card of the main mobile operator is installed on the SIM1 position, and the SIM card of the backup operator is installed on the SIM2 position, if necessary. The system will switch to a backup operator in case of loss of the network of the main operator or failures in the transmission of SMS through it.

SENSOR CONTROL INPUTS

Up to 4 zones can be allocated on a controlled object. Each of the zones can be represented by a resistor and any required number of sensors connected in one loop and connected to one of the 4 controller inputs and the "COM" terminal.

The recommended total loop resistance is 3.6 kOhm. With this resistance, the voltage at the zone input will be approximately 7.2V. This is 50% of the voltage that occurs at the zone input when the loop breaks (100% corresponds to the voltage at the battery terminals).

The zone is considered violated if the voltage at the zone input goes beyond the specified range (normal). By default, this range is set from 25% to 75%. Thus, a break in the loop (voltage = 100%) or shorting the input to the "COM" terminal (voltage = 0%) will trigger the input. The range limits can be changed separately for each


GSM ANTENNA

Upon delivery, the controller is equipped with a detachable GSM standard antenna with a cable length of 2.5 m. Connector type - SMA.

It is unacceptable to place the antenna inside a metal box or in close proximity to metal structures.

POWER ADAPTER

The system delivery set includes a power supply unit for connecting the controller to the 220V network.

Input voltage: ~200V... 240V
Output voltage: 18V... 21V
Load current: up to 300mA
Operation temperature of the built-in thermal fuse: +1350С

To avoid overheating and subsequent irreversible tripping of the thermal fuse, it is necessary to ensure free air flow to the power supply.

BACKUP BATTERY 12V

The backup battery is connected to the controller through a specially designed for this nest.

Any lead-acid battery with a voltage of 12V and a capacity of up to 7.2A/h can be used as a backup battery. Such batteries are traditionally used in security systems and uninterruptible power supplies for personal computers.

If a battery with a much larger capacity is to be used (for example, a car battery), then it must be fully charged before connecting to the controller.

REMOTE DIGITAL THERMAL SENSORS

Remote digital temperature sensors operate in the range from -550С to +1250С with an accuracy of ±0.50С. The measured temperature values ​​are sent to the controller in the form of a digital code.

Temperature sensors are connected to the controller via the connector for the Touch Memory electronic key reader.

Each temperature sensor is completed with a 10m cable for connection to the controller.

The temperature sensor is not sealed and is not intended to be immersed in liquid.

If it is necessary to measure the temperature of the heat carrier in the pipe, it is recommended to tie the temperature sensor to the pipe with a heat-insulating tape. The length of the bandaged part of the pipe is 15-20 cm. When metal pipe to prevent damage to the sensor by stray currents, it is necessary to lay a layer of heat-resistant dielectric at least 5 mm thick between the sensor and the pipe.

EXPANSION UNITS

Additional expansion blocks allow you to increase the number of control zones and relays for controlling actuators.

The expansion units are connected to the controller via the connector for the Touch Memory electronic key reader.

The number of control zones (entrances) - 12.
The number of built-in relays is 4.
The maximum distance of the expansion unit from the controller is 100m.
The maximum number of expansion units in the system is 3

Each expansion unit is supplied with a 10m connection cable to the controller. The connection procedure and unit control commands are described in the operating manual of the extension unit.

TOUCH MEMORY KEY READER

The Touch Memory electronic key reader does not contain any key identification schemes.

The reader is completed with a 10m cable for connection to the controller. Up to three readers can be installed in the system.

MASTER KEY TOUCH MEMORY

The Touch Memory master key is used to register additional dongles.

The master key can be used to arm and disarm the system, but it is recommended to use additionally registered keys for this.

The master key is hard-wired to a specific instance of the processor installed in the KSITAL GSM controller.

Restoring a lost master key is possible only at a service center and requires a complete reprogramming of the controller.

TOUCH MEMORY KEYS

Together with the KSITAL GSM controller, electronic keys DS1990A manufactured by Dallas Semiconductor or compatible are used.

The keys are used to arm and disarm the system (see the "Mode Control" section).

Up to 6 Touch Memory electronic keys (except for the master key) can be registered in the system.

In the process of registration electronic key its indelible code is stored in the controller's memory, which allows the same key to be registered in several access control devices.

DETECTORS, SENSORS

The type of sensors used and their installation locations are selected based on the individual characteristics of the object. As detectors for operation in conjunction with the KSITAL GSM system, any sensors that, when triggered, can break or close the circuit, can be used.

It is possible to connect sensors with "open collector" type output with admissible current switching over 2mA.

For easy connection of sensors requiring an external voltage source, +12V voltage is provided at the controller terminals.

The total current consumed by the sensors from the +12V controller terminals must not exceed 160mA.

If more current is needed, a separate power supply for the sensors should be used. It is desirable that the additional power supply be with its own backup battery.

EXECUTIVE DEVICES

Up to three actuators can be connected to the system at the same time. These can be: a siren, a heater, water or gas supply valves or a control system for heating, air conditioning, ventilation, irrigation, sauna, lighting, etc.

Control of these devices is possible both automatically using the controller program, and forcibly using SMS commands sent from your cell phone.

Connecting powerful electrical appliances (more than 200 watts), electric motors is made through intermediate relays (contactors) of the appropriate power.

REMOTE MICROPHONE

Microphones of this type have a built-in amplifier and three wires for connection. Microphones of the MKU and SHOROH series can be cited as an example. These microphones are similar in characteristics, but differ in design. In practice, the MKU series showed slightly better shielding and, as a result, higher noise immunity.

TERMINAL "CONTROL"

Depending on the contents of the entry in the 51st cell of the telephone directory on the SIM card, the "Control" terminal can be used as:

Analog input to measure the voltage applied to this terminal in the range from 0 to 12V;
an input that controls the arming / disarming of the system from control by applying a voltage of 12V to it (+12V - the system is under control, 0V - control is removed). This allows you to use remote controls and security panels from third-party manufacturers to control the system;
open collector output. Allows you to control the load up to 100mA at voltage up to 15V. To control a more powerful load, an intermediate relay should be used.

What is the difference between Xital 4 and Xital 4T

The Xital 4T version comes with 2 wired temperature sensors pre-configured to work with the system. There are no such sensors in the Xital 4 version (which is why it is cheaper). Also in the "T" version, a special reader with two outputs to the thermal sensor loops is included. Messages about power failure in Xital GSM 4T are sent to all user numbers, and in Xital 4 only to the main number.

What are the costs of using this system?

The Xital system is connected directly to the "brains" of the heating boiler and controls the heating on by its own temperature sensors. When leaving home, the user sets the minimum temperature (for example, 10 °C), and when arriving, several hours in advance, using SMS, he sets a comfortable temperature (for example, 25 °C). Thus, during the absence, the boiler does not work 90% of the time, saving gas, electricity and other fuels.

Please note that you can separately set the temperatures for day and night.
